Understand Your Right to Compensation in Arkansas

A Slip and Fall is the usual term linked with accidents involving someone slipping, tripping or falling on someone else's property as a result of a hazardous condition. The owner of property in Ward could be liable to you if you fell and hurt yourself while on their property.

Causes of Slip and Falls in Ward Arkansas

Slip and Falls occur because of a hazardous or dangerous condition on the property in Arkansas.

These conditions are categorized loosely into three categories: 1) structural defects occurring as buildings get older and need repair, 2) hazards created by weather, like icy sidewalks, and 3) building code violations where a property owner has not taken reasonable steps to ensure that the property meets all local safety requirements.

The type of evidence you will need to show to prove your injury may depend on what type of Slip and Fall case you have in Ward.
